Revenue
In the second quarter of fiscal year 2026, GK Energy Ltd reported a total income of ₹405.92 crores, reflecting a significant quarter-over-quarter growth of 24.4% from ₹326.40 crores in Q1FY26. The absence of year-over-year comparative data for Q2FY25 is notable, as it prevents a full assessment of annual revenue trends. The robust quarterly increase in revenue suggests a period of strong sales performance or enhanced service delivery during Q2FY26. This increase in total income is a critical component in evaluating the company's operational scale and market presence in the current financial period.
Profitability
GK Energy Ltd achieved a profit before tax of ₹62.71 crores in Q2FY26, marking a quarter-over-quarter increase of 24.1% from ₹50.52 crores in Q1FY26. After accounting for tax expenses of ₹15.80 crores, the company recorded a profit after tax of ₹46.91 crores, up 25.7% from the previous quarter's ₹37.31 crores. The earnings per share for Q2FY26 rose to ₹2.31 from ₹2.19 in Q1FY26, representing a 5.5% increase. Operating Metrics
GK Energy Ltd's total expenses for Q2FY26 stood at ₹343.20 crores, indicating a quarter-over-quarter increase of 24.4% from ₹275.88 crores in Q1FY26. This increase in expenses mirrors the growth in total income, suggesting that operational scaling may have driven cost increases. The tax liability for the quarter also grew by 19.6% to ₹15.80 crores from ₹13.21 crores in the previous quarter.
